summaryrefslogtreecommitdiff
path: root/src/libsystemd/sd-bus/bus-socket.c
Commit message (Expand)AuthorAgeFilesLines
* sd-bus: use the new information in the client's sockaddr in the creds structureLennart Poettering2023-05-161-0/+11
* sd-bus: bind outgoing AF_UNIX sockets to abstract addresses conveying client ...Lennart Poettering2023-05-161-0/+49
* tree-wide: port more code over to CMSG_TYPED_DATA()Lennart Poettering2023-04-131-4/+4
* tree-wide: use FORK_REARRANGE_STDIO and FORK_CLOSE_ALL_FDSYu Watanabe2023-02-211-8/+3
* process-util: rename FORK_NULL_STDIO -> FORK_REARRANGE_STDIOYu Watanabe2023-02-211-1/+4
* tree-wide: set FORK_RLIMIT_NOFILE_SAFE flagYu Watanabe2023-02-071-4/+1
* sd-bus: handle -EINTR return from bus_poll()Lennart Poettering2022-11-221-1/+4
* bus: Process authentication after writeMarius Vollmer2022-10-041-31/+35
* bus: use inline trace argument for ANONYMOUS authDavid Rheinsberg2022-08-051-52/+62
* basic/socket-util: rename fd_inc_rcvbuf → fd_increase_rxbufZbigniew Jędrzejewski-Szmek2022-06-301-1/+1
* sd-bus: use ALIGN8()Yu Watanabe2022-06-011-1/+1
* libsystemd: ignore both EINTR and EAGAINYu Watanabe2021-11-301-9/+11
* Change gendered terms to be gender-neutral (#21325)Emily Gonyer2021-11-121-2/+2
* escape: add flags argument to quote_command_line()Lennart Poettering2021-11-111-1/+1
* tree-wide: always use TAKE_FD() when calling rearrange_stdio()Lennart Poettering2021-11-031-1/+3
* alloc-util: add strdupa_safe() + strndupa_safe() and use it everywhereLennart Poettering2021-10-141-1/+2
* tree-wide: use memmem_safe()Lennart Poettering2021-08-101-3/+3
* sd-bus: print quoted commandline when in bus_socket_exec()Zbigniew Jędrzejewski-Szmek2021-07-091-6/+14
* basic,shared: move a bunch of files to src/shared/Zbigniew Jędrzejewski-Szmek2021-06-241-1/+0
* alloc-util: simplify GREEDY_REALLOC() logic by relying on malloc_usable_size()Lennart Poettering2021-05-191-3/+3
* tree-wide: use UINT64_MAX or friendsYu Watanabe2021-03-051-1/+1
* license: LGPL-2.1+ -> LGPL-2.1-or-laterYu Watanabe2020-11-091-1/+1
* sd-bus: add debug logs where we try to connectZbigniew Jędrzejewski-Szmek2020-10-141-0/+10
* sd-bus: fix error handling on readv()Lennart Poettering2020-08-201-4/+8
* tree-wide: port to fd_wait_for_event()Lennart Poettering2020-06-101-14/+6
* tree-wide: check POLLNVAL everywhereLennart Poettering2020-06-101-0/+2
* tree-wide: make sure our control buffers are properly alignedLennart Poettering2020-05-071-8/+2
* tree-wide: use CMSG_SPACE() (and not CMSG_LEN()) to allocate control buffersLennart Poettering2020-05-071-2/+4
* tree-wide: use structured initialization at various placesLennart Poettering2020-04-241-15/+16
* tree-wide: use recvmsg_safe() at various placesLennart Poettering2020-04-231-8/+22
* tree-wide: drop missing.hYu Watanabe2019-10-311-1/+0
* sd-bus: maintain a counter for incoming msgsLennart Poettering2019-07-111-0/+1
* sd-bus: reduce scope of variableZbigniew Jędrzejewski-Szmek2019-03-201-4/+2
* bus: fix memleak on invalid messageZbigniew Jędrzejewski-Szmek2019-03-181-2/+4
* sd-bus: skip sending formatted UIDs via SASLDavid Rheinsberg2019-03-141-38/+63
* sd-bus: fix SASL reply to empty AUTHDavid Rheinsberg2019-03-141-2/+8
* sd-bus: avoid magic number in SASL length calculationDavid Rheinsberg2019-03-141-2/+6
* util: split out memcmp()/memset() related calls into memory-util.[ch]Lennart Poettering2019-03-131-1/+1
* sd-bus: use "queue" message references for managing r/w message queues in con...Lennart Poettering2019-03-011-2/+4
* sd-bus: if we receive an invalid dbus message, ignore and proceeedLennart Poettering2019-02-141-3/+6
* tree-wide: use newa() instead of alloca() wherever we canLennart Poettering2019-01-261-1/+1
* tree-wide: invoke rlimit_nofile_safe() before various exec{v,ve,l}() invocationsLennart Poettering2018-12-011-0/+3
* tree-wide: use IOVEC_MAKE() at many placesLennart Poettering2018-11-271-15/+7
* bus-socket: Fix line_begins() to accept word matching full stringFilipe Brandenburger2018-07-171-4/+1
* tree-wide: drop empty commentsYu Watanabe2018-06-291-2/+0
* tree-wide: drop MSG_NOSIGNAL flag from recvmsg() invocationsLennart Poettering2018-06-201-2/+2
* tree-wide: remove Lennart's copyright linesLennart Poettering2018-06-141-1/+0
* tree-wide: drop 'This file is part of systemd' blurbLennart Poettering2018-06-141-2/+0
* tree-wide: make use of memory_startswith() at various placesLennart Poettering2018-05-301-7/+4
* path-util: introduce empty_to_root() and use it many placesYu Watanabe2018-05-111-1/+1